I just purchased my first new car, a Kia Sedona EX.  It was about 8-10k less
than the comparably equipped Fords and Chryslers.

One question I have is that the dealer wanted to sell this
paintprotector/rustproofing package.  Is this a waste like most other dealer
ad ons who want to try to bump the profit at the last minute?

Thanks for any info - 22 miles and going strong :)
hyundaitech - 10 Aug 2004 18:07 GMT
I wouldn't even consider something like this.  I might consider the
rustproofing alone if I lived in a rust belt area, but remember that you
can probably get this much cheaper elsewhere.

I'm 3500 km and going strong!  I didn't get the dealer undercoating.
There's a place in town that does it cheaper, and I think perhaps better.  I
think that most dealers send it out to get it done anyway, so why bother?
I'm going to have it done before winter.

I love my Sedona.  Works great, good value!  It does get poor mileage, but I
knew that before buying it.  Although, there's a full steel frame, so you're
paying more for extra weight which means extra safety, IMHO.  Besides, we
saved a bunch up front, so we pay a bit more later one.

I did replace the Kumho 798's after 300 km.  Bought a new set of Michelin
Harmony (including the spare), and the difference is great!
